2012 ISK to MVR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2012

During 2012, the ISK to MVR ex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on August 7, valuing the pair at 0.1293.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on June 3, dropping to 0.1079.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 0.0214 MVR.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 0.1139 to the December average rate of 0.1213, the exchange rate registered a net change of 6.47% (reflecting a strengthening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2012 high of 0.1293 was up 3.72% compared to the 2011 peak of 0.1247,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.

Monthly Breakdown

Statistical summary for each calendar month.

Month High Low Average
January 0.1156 0.1120 0.1139
February 0.1154 0.1120 0.1143
March 0.1126 0.1104 0.1115
April 0.1121 0.1098 0.1111
May 0.1137 0.1080 0.1110
June 0.1134 0.1079 0.1105
July 0.1275 0.1090 0.1192
August 0.1293 0.1261 0.1281
September 0.1270 0.1239 0.1256
October 0.1271 0.1209 0.1243
November 0.1224 0.1194 0.1211
December 0.1230 0.1197 0.1213
